Position Summary

The Community Programs Manager leads the planning, implementation, and daily operations of CAL’s year-round ArtWorks program, a youth arts workforce development initiative serving teen apprentices. Working in close collaboration with the Chief Operating Officer, Chief Executive Officer, and Development staff, this role ensures program excellence through a holistic approach that integrates youth development, high-quality arts instruction, workforce readiness, and community partnerships. The Community Programs Manager serves as a central connector between leadership, teaching artists, apprentices, and community partners, aligning vision with execution to ensure program goals, funding requirements, and participant outcomes are met. This position supervises onsite programming, supports teaching artists, manages administrative systems, and contributes to evaluation, reporting, and long-term program sustainability.
